Brush Fire Breaks Out in Topanga Canyon

The blaze is reported about 12:15 p.m. in the 1200 block of Old Topanga Canyon Road.

A brush fire broke out Tuesday in the Topanga area, scorching about a half-acre before being brought under control.

The blaze was reported about 12:15 p.m. in the 1200 block of Old Topanga Canyon Road. Some power lines were reported down in the area.

By 2:30 p.m., county fire Inspector Scott Miller said crews had "a good handle" on the blaze, which was 70 percent contained. He said that there were no injuries or evacuations.

The firefighting effort was being conducted amid a red flag warning in effect over much of the Southland due to gusty winds and single-digit humidity levels.
